"""redact_for_telemetry is the wall between a model_error diagnostic and a key
|
|
leak: in own_key mode the subprocess stderr we now attach can echo the user's
|
|
provider key, so these tests pin that no secret shape survives while the actual
|
|
error text (the whole point of capturing stderr) does.
|
|
|
|
The secret-shaped inputs are built by concatenation on purpose: no contiguous
|
|
key-shaped literal lands in this source file (so it never trips gitleaks or
|
|
alarms a reader), yet the runtime values are still key-shaped enough to exercise
|
|
the scrub. None of these are real keys; they unlock nothing."""
